浏览代码

crypto: cts - Remove bogus use of seqiv

The seqiv generator is completely inappropriate for cts as it's
designed for IPsec algorithms.  Since cts users do not actually
use the IV generator we can just fall back to the default.

Signed-off-by: Herbert Xu <herbert@gondor.apana.org.au>
Acked-by: Maciej ?enczykowski <zenczykowski@gmail.com>
Herbert Xu 10 年之前
父节点
当前提交
0c5c8e646c
共有 1 个文件被更改,包括 0 次插入2 次删除
  1. 0 2
      crypto/cts.c

+ 0 - 2
crypto/cts.c

@@ -307,8 +307,6 @@ static struct crypto_instance *crypto_cts_alloc(struct rtattr **tb)
 	inst->alg.cra_blkcipher.min_keysize = alg->cra_blkcipher.min_keysize;
 	inst->alg.cra_blkcipher.min_keysize = alg->cra_blkcipher.min_keysize;
 	inst->alg.cra_blkcipher.max_keysize = alg->cra_blkcipher.max_keysize;
 	inst->alg.cra_blkcipher.max_keysize = alg->cra_blkcipher.max_keysize;
 
 
-	inst->alg.cra_blkcipher.geniv = "seqiv";
-
 	inst->alg.cra_ctxsize = sizeof(struct crypto_cts_ctx);
 	inst->alg.cra_ctxsize = sizeof(struct crypto_cts_ctx);
 
 
 	inst->alg.cra_init = crypto_cts_init_tfm;
 	inst->alg.cra_init = crypto_cts_init_tfm;